Comprehending Wooden Pallet ClearanceWhat is Wooden Pallet Clearance?
Wooden pallet clearance describes the procedure of disposing of or repurposing surplus wooden pallets that are no longer suitable for transporting goods. This can involve selling, recycling, or recycling these pallets. Companies frequently collect a considerable variety of wooden pallets, causing mess and logistical difficulties within storage facilities or storage facilities.
Why is Wooden Pallet Clearance Important?Area Management: Excess pallets can use up valuable flooring space, causing inadequacies within a facility.Safety: Stacked or lost wooden pallets can posture safety hazards in the workplace, increasing the risk of accidents.Environmental Impact: Disposing of wooden pallets poorly can add to garbage dump waste. Sustainable disposal or repurposing can reduce these impacts.Expense Efficiency: Efficiently managing wooden pallets can save money, as incorrect handling may lead to unneeded disposal costs.Kinds Of Wooden Pallet Clearance
Comprehending the choices offered for wooden pallet clearance is essential. The most typical opportunities consist of:
TypeDescriptionBenefitsOfferingPallets can be offered to services concentrating on pallet reselling or repair work.Recoups some initial financial investment; minimizes waste.RecyclingBroken or unusable pallets can typically be recycled into mulch, wood chips, or other products.Environmentally friendly; supports sustainability efforts.RepurposingPallets can be changed into furnishings, decor items, or garden structures.Creative reuse; potential profit return from selling crafts.ContributionDonate to non-profits, schools, or community gardens that can use pallets in their projects.Contributes positively to the neighborhood; tax advantages possible.Land fill DisposalThe last option for pallets that can not be offered, reused, or recycled.Easiest option, but not environmentally sustainable.How to Implement Wooden Pallet Clearance
Companies ought to take a strategic approach to carry out effective wooden pallet clearance. Here are some tips and steps to think about:
Steps for Effective ClearanceInventory Assessment: Conduct a stock assessment to identify the variety of pallets available and their condition.Classification: Sort pallets into classifications: usable, repairable, and non-usable.Figure Out Disposal Methods: Choose the most appropriate clearance approach based on the classifications identified.Research regional regulations: Understand local laws concerning pallet disposal and recycling.Execute a Clearance Schedule: Set a routine schedule for pallet clearance to keep the stock handled regularly.Helpful TipsContact Local Businesses: Reach out to local farms, schools, and artisans who might take advantage of excess usable pallets.Use Online Platforms: Use online marketplaces such as Craigslist or Facebook Marketplace to sell or contribute pallets effectively.Engage Employees: Encourage workers to take part in conceptualizing sessions for imaginative reuse ideas.Inspect Regularly: Make pallet examinations a part of routine maintenance to recognize prospective clearance opportunities.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What should I do if my pallets are damaged?
If pallets are harmed, examine if they can be repaired. Many pallets can be refurbished and sold. If they are permanent, think about recycling or repurposing them.
2. How much can I offer wooden pallets for?
The rate of wooden pallets can vary based upon type, condition, and local market need. Typically, rates range from ₤ 5 to ₤ 20 per pallet.
3. Exist business that will get my pallets?
Yes, several companies concentrate on pallet recycling, reselling, and collection. Research study regional businesses that provide these services.
4. What are some ingenious recycling ideas for wooden pallets?
Common ideas consist of furnishings (e.g., coffee tables, benches), garden planters, storage solutions, and ornamental art pieces.
